Giving something that lasts past the party
A griha pravesh gift sits in someone's home for years, so it is worth a little more thought than the usual sweets and a card. The best housewarming presents do one of two things: they bless the new space, or they help fill a wall or a shelf that is still bare on moving day. We will cover both, with pieces that suit a range of budgets and tastes.
The one rule we follow: give something the host would not feel obliged to hide in a cupboard. That means avoiding anything too loud or too personal to your own taste.

Matching the gift to the relationship
Close family can lean into the devotional pieces, since you know the household and its faith. For colleagues or newer friends, a neutral sculpture or vase is the safer call, because it carries warmth without assuming anything about how they worship or decorate. When in doubt, pick the piece that goes with everything.
Common questions
What is a safe griha pravesh gift if I do not know their taste?
A neutral vase with a faux arrangement, or a calm sculpture in a single metallic or natural finish. Both fill a space, suit most interiors, and do not assume a particular religion or style.
Is an idol an appropriate housewarming gift?
For a traditional griha pravesh, yes, and it is one of the most meaningful gifts you can give. Just be sure the household keeps a pooja space, and match the deity to the family where you can.
How much should I spend on a housewarming gift?
Spend on quality over size. One well-made handcrafted piece outlasts a basket of small items, and it is the thing the host will still have years later.
